How can countries close the equity gap in education?

by Dirk Van Damme
Head of the Skills Beyond School Division,  Directorate for Education and Skills


Education plays a dual role when it comes to social inequality and social mobility. On the one hand, it is the main way for societies to foster equality of opportunity and support upward social mobility for children from disadvantaged backgrounds. On the other hand, the evidence is overwhelming that education often reproduces social divides in societies, through the impact that parents’ economic, social and cultural status has on children’s learning outcomes.

The social divide is already apparent very early in the life of a child, in the time their parents spend on parenting or in the number of words a toddler learns. It progresses through early childhood education and becomes most obvious in the variation in learning outcomes, based on social background, among 15-year-old students who participate in the Programme for International Student Assessment (PISA). And when literacy and numeracy skills among adults are assessed, such as in the OECD Survey of Adult Skills (PIAAC), we still see the impact of socio-economic status on skills development. A new report, Educational Opportunities for All, which contributes to the OECD Inclusive Growth initiative, charts the trajectory of educational inequality over a lifetime using OECD datasets on education and learning outcomes.

Children from disadvantaged families, measured by the proxy of parents’ educational attainment, have less chance than their peers from more advantaged backgrounds to benefit from early childhood education and excellent learning opportunities at school. The later stages in a person’s educational career often reinforce the accumulated disadvantage from previous stages.

The chart above shows,for the cohort born between 1985 and 1988, that the impact of social background continues to be strong between the age of 15, when students sit the PISA reading test, and the ages of 25-28, when PIAAC conducts a similar test in literacy. In most cases, the difference in the standardised scores between children with tertiary-educated parents and those without a tertiary-educated parent increases between the two measurements. This is probably because poor literacy proficiency at school translates into different trajectories into further education, into more difficult transitions between school and work, and into work environments that offer fewer opportunities to improve literacy skills either by using those skills or through training.

Is this then a completely pessimistic story? Should we forget about the potential of education to foster a more equal and inclusive society? Not at all! The report shows that children’s educational trajectory is not set in stone. Many children seem to be able to move beyond the destiny to which their background seems to condemn them. But there are large differences among countries in the extent to which these children succeed in school. The report includes a dashboard of 11 indicators of equity in education – a clear sign that policies and practices matter. The right policies and the right kind of incentives can make a huge difference in whether a country is able to provide educational opportunities for all.

Throughout its work on learning, education and skills, the OECD has identified policies that matter with regard to equity. Those identified in this new report are not surprising: invest in accessible, high-quality early childhood education; improve learning opportunities for children at risk and target resources to those schools that need them most; focus on employability skills for adults from disadvantaged backgrounds; and provide opportunities for second-chance and lifelong education.

There is no magic formula that will work for all countries. In some countries, a lack of quality early childhood education creates huge equity issues, while in others, secondary school is the stage at which equality of educational opportunity is jeopardised. In still other countries, it is the transition to work that is the most challenging for disadvantaged young people. As shown in the chart above, Sweden, New Zealand and Norway are relatively successful in guaranteeing equitable learning outcomes in secondary school. But in contrast to the two Nordic countries, New Zealand doesn’t seem able to extend its equitable approach into skills development among young adults, probably because of segregating mechanisms in work allocation and adult learning programmes.

The Flemish Community of Belgium provides a contrasting picture: the secondary school system there shows large disparities in learning outcomes between disadvantaged and advantaged children, but the inequitable outcomes are, to some extent, compensated in early adulthood by more inclusive labour-market and social-protection systems. Countries thus need to search for the specific mix of policies that will work for them.

More equitable and inclusive education and skills policies are not only beneficial for individual people; they can have a huge impact on society. Such policies can guarantee that the routes to upward social mobility remain open to talented people, regardless of their social background. Countries will benefit socially and economically when they stop wasting the talents of those who are penalised simply because of where they came from. At a time when skills are the ticket to brighter futures, developing everyone’s skills is the best strategy towards economic prosperity and social cohesion.

Is the growth of international student mobility coming to a halt?

by Dirk Van Damme
Head of the Skills Beyond School Division,  Directorate for Education and Skills


Higher education is one of the most globally integrated systems of the modern world. There still are important barriers to the international recognition of degrees or the transfer of credits, but some of the basic features of higher education enjoy global convergence and collaboration. This is most visible in the research area, where advanced research is now carried out in international networks. But also in the field of teaching and learning, the international dimension has become very important. The so-called European Higher Education Area stands out as an area where degree structures, credit transfer arrangements and quality assurance frameworks have been aligned in order to adjust qualifications with the needs of an integrated labour market.

Yet, higher education is also one of the most unequal and hierarchical systems of the modern world; globalisation has not yet made the world of higher education a ‘flat’ one. There are huge imbalances between the quantitative supply and demand of education. And the imbalance in quality is even more striking: using an imperfect measure of quality such as the one provided by the global university rankings, one can immediately see that the perceived quality and reputation of academic institutions is concentrated in just a few countries, while the demand is exploding in other parts of the world. The academic top league (say, the top 50 institutions in any of the global rankings) is particularly concentrated, and because of the metrics used to determine quality it is very difficult for institutions in other parts of the world to enter that club.

To some extent international student mobility can be seen as a consequence of global academic inequality. Students are moving to other parts of the globe in order to find the best possible education their money can buy. International student mobility is one of the ways through which the geographical gap between supply and demand is being overcome. Investing resources in one’s son or daughter in order to secure them a high-quality credential has become a preferred strategy of affluent middle class families in emerging countries, especially after their purchasing power started to increase. The chart above shows that for many years the total number of international students remained rather stable around 1 million, but that from the 1990s onwards the numbers started to grow significantly. Some countries were quick to tap into this opportunity and developed strategies to market their higher education offer. From 0.8 million in 1975, the number rose to 4.2 million thirty-five years later.

Many people expected the growth to continue and even to accelerate. But that is not what happened, as is also clear from the chart. From 2012 onwards the growth really stopped. Between 2012 and 2015 a mere 100 thousand students were added to the 4.5 million. The recent figures, published in the OECD’s latest Education at a Glance, suggest that it is not just a temporary setback, but a more structural phenomenon.

What could be the reasons for this change? We probably need to look at developments both on the demand and the supply side. Regarding the former, the obvious explanation is the improvement of domestic education in the most important countries of origin. China, and to a lesser extent India, have invested huge resources in developing their higher education system, including a select number of universities that are predestined to achieve world-class status in the next few years. Chinese universities are now aggressively entering the global rankings and continue to improve their ranks every single year. Changing prospects at home have an impact on the investments strategies of affluent middle-class families in these nations.

Still, changes on the demand side alone cannot explain the lack of growth. Indeed, the potential reservoir of interested students in these countries remains immense. We also have to look at the supply side, to developments in the main countries of destination. It is evident that in the main countries active in the field of exporting education services, things have fundamentally changed as well. From a very hospitable and welcoming approach to international students, popular and political attitudes have reversed things into a much more hostile stance. This has happened in the main destination countries such as Australia, the UK and the US, but also in upcoming players such as Switzerland, Sweden or the Netherlands. The general backlash against migration, aggravated by the refugee crisis and the flows of asylum seekers, has also turned the climate for foreign students upside down. Populist and often false accusations that foreign students are only interested in permanent migration, and that they take the future jobs of domestic students, are now in the media every day.

The recent 2017 Open Doors Report on International Educational Exchange data, published by the Institute of International Education (IIE), points to a decrease of 7% in the numbers of new international students enrolling in US higher education institutions. The majority of surveyed institutions (52%) in the IIE survey expressed concern that the country’s social and political climate could deter prospective international students. In the UK, a political decision is being discussed of removing international students from the government’s target of reducing net immigration. Still, Brexit and a general hostile climate against migration in the UK is probably also becoming a deterrent for international students. Similar developments can be seen in other countries of destination.

What is happening at both the demand and supply side of international higher education is fundamentally reshaping the size and direction of international student mobility flows. In a strange way, they are reshaping the global academic inequalities. At the same time they are also redefining where and how the future professionals and leaders of the 21st century world will be educated. Just as much as academic education was an important instrument in shaping the post-WWII global order, the current changes in international education will have a profound impact on the 21st century world.

Is international academic migration stimulating scientific research and innovation?

by Dirk Van Damme
Head of the Innovation and Measuring Division, Directorate for Education and Skills



Higher education and academic research are among the most rapidly globalising systems. Today, around 5 million students study and do research in a country other than their own, attracted by the quality of overseas universities and willing to complement their education portfolio with international experience. Employers generally value the impact international education has on the skills and mind-set of graduates, and see international experience as indispensable for future global leaders.

But in an age when governments are increasingly concerned about rising levels of migration and are making their migration policies more stringent, international student mobility is also being scrutinised. Some countries impose stricter visa requirements or limitations on the time for international students to stay in the country. Others make it more difficult for graduates to stay and work in the country where they have studied. The prospect of losing the economic returns from international students and the income provided by fee-paying students does not seem to dissuade some governments from imposing stricter regulations on international students.

The recent Education Indicators in Focus brief looks in more detail at the international mobility of master’s and doctoral students. The mobility of doctoral students is of special concern because of its relevance to research policy. The chart above illustrates the close relationship between the number of international doctoral students in a country and the country’s commitment to research, as measured by spending on R&D in tertiary education. Countries with a large share of international doctoral students are also countries that invest a lot in research.

The chart does not suggest any causality. In fact, there are two ways to interpret the relationship. Countries with relatively high levels of investment in university research are probably well-integrated in global research networks. International collaboration naturally leads to an exchange of researchers. Favourable research climates, high levels of investment and the prospect of collaborating with researchers working at the cutting edge in their fields offer attractive opportunities for young doctoral researchers.

The global research landscape is diversifying. Next to the academic centres in the United States and the United Kingdom, new strongholds of global academic research are emerging in countries such as Switzerland, the Netherlands and Sweden. These countries have opened up their universities for international researchers, and now 30%, 40% or even more than 50% of the doctoral students in these countries are of foreign origin.

But it could very well be that the causality also works in the other direction. Higher numbers of international researchers probably contribute to the global competiveness of academic research by strengthening integration in research networks or by facilitating international knowledge transfer. We can find support for this hypothesis in comparing our data on the percentage of international doctoral students with OECD data on the share of publications in the top 10% academic journals. The strong country-level correlation between both sets of data suggests that doctoral students have a positive impact on the quantity and quality of scientific research in the host country. In turn, this could prompt governments to increase their R&D spending on universities. Indirectly, international students then contribute to the innovation process and the development of a research-intensive knowledge economy in the host country.

The case of Switzerland is telling. A small country in the heart of Europe that is now fiercely debating migration policy, Switzerland has opened up its universities to international researchers and doctoral students, while at the same time increasing its R&D investment. Anyone who looks at international rankings has noticed that Switzerland is rising rapidly up the global academic hierarchy. Sweden and the Netherlands are close behind. This is no coincidence.

Current debates about international student mobility tend to overemphasise the benefits for the individual student or the financial returns for the host institution or host country. But it is also important to look into the wider benefits of academic migration. Laboratories and research centres at the frontier of their fields cannot do without strong integration in global networks and without international researchers. Progress in scientific research happens by sharing and confronting ideas, questioning established wisdom and looking at the world from different perspectives. International exchange and mobility of doctoral researchers is absolutely critical to this. Countries that curtail academic mobility risk paying a high price.
